About Agnés Soucat
Dr Agnes Soucat is the Director of the Division of Health and Social Protection of the France Development Agency (AFD). She previously was the Director of the Department of Health Systems, Governance and Financing at the World Health Organization (WHO). Dr Soucat previously held the positions of Director for Human Development for the African Development Bank, where she was responsible for health, education and social protection for 53 African countries, and of Global Lead Economist, Health, Nutrition and Population for the World Bank. She has over 30 years of experience in health and poverty reduction, covering more than 70 countries in Africa, Asia and Europe. She was a pioneer of several innovations in health care financing including community and performance based financing and authored seminal publications on these topics. She is also the co-author of the World Development Report 2004 “Making Services Work for Poor People” and of the Lancet Commission report “Global Health 2035: a world converging within a generation”. She was commissioner of the Lancet and Rockefeller Commission on Planetary Health. Dr Soucat did also extensive work on health labor market dynamics in Africa. Dr Soucat holds an MD and a Masters in Nutrition from the University of Nancy in France as well as a Master of Public Health and Ph.D in Health Economics from the Johns Hopkins University.
